5 Powerful Ways to Use Google Drive in Schools

How to automate school processes with Google Drive


Google Drive is a free cloud storage platform provided by Google to every Gmail account holder. It is also part of the powerful range of tools that come with the G-Suite for Education. With this free cloud storage, schools can pursue a paperless system, which has become a 21st century norm.

a. Google Drive can be used by schools to permanently secure their important files.
There is no better way to secure some important school files than to save it in the cloud, where you can always access it, even if you lose your current device to theft or damage

b. Teachers can create folders for each of their students in Google Drive. This makes sorting student’s files easy. Simply create folders for each child in your class and send every material related to the child to the specific folder.

c. Google Drive is used to create hyperlink for every kind of file- audio, video, graphic, text etc. Every web page is hyperlinked, that's why they are shareable. All you need to access a web page is just to grab it's hyperlink, otherwise called the universal resource locator (url). 

But for non-web files (like some of those files you have right now in your system- audio, video, graphic, text etc), the only way to make them shareable and accessible to others is by creating a hyperlink for them. And that is where you need the Google Drive.


d. With Google Drive, Newsletters, students' results and every form of regular dispatch to parents can easily be hyperlinked and sent to parents for easy perusal. With this, there is no need wasting paper and ink on these materials.

e. With Google Drive, schools can run a complete paperless system, where every academic and administrative processes can flow seamlessly without the need for paper work.

Whether it's teachers submitting their lesson plans to their sectional heads or teachers posting the students study materials to individual folders; just think of anything you've been spending money on paper for. Even examination questions can be saved in the Drive cloud pending to the time of the exam.
